What is Software Accessibility Testing?
Software accessibility testing is the process of evaluating whether a digital product can be effectively used by people with visual, motor, hearing, or cognitive disabilities.
It evaluate features like keyboard-only navigation, screen reader compatibility, color constrast & visibility, alt text for images, captions & transcipts and form labeling. Unlike functional testing, accessibility testing answer "can everyone access this experience?"

Web Accessibility Testing Service
We audit web applications and websites against WCAG 2.1 and 2.2 (Level A, AA, and AAA), using a combination of automated scanning and expert manual testing with real screen readers, keyboard-only navigation, and browser accessibility tools. Deliverable includes a prioritised audit report and VPAT documentation.
Mobile App Accessibility Testing
We validate iOS and Android apps against WCAG mobile criteria, Apple Human Interface Guidelines (HIG), and Android Accessibility Guidelines. Testing includes VoiceOver, TalkBack, Switch Control, and Voice Access across real devices — not simulators — covering touch target sizing, focus order, dynamic type, and gesture alternatives.
Desktop Software Accessibility Testing
Windows, macOS, and cross-platform apps face distinct accessibility challenges. We test keyboard navigation completeness, focus management, ARIA role implementation, NVDA and JAWS compatibility, high-contrast mode support, and Section 508 ICT compliance for enterprise and government software.
SaaS Platform Accessibility Testing
SaaS products serving enterprise clients and regulated industries face growing procurement accessibility requirements, including VPAT demands and EAA compliance. We provide end-to-end accessibility audits, Voluntary Product Accessibility Template (VPAT) documentation, and ongoing accessibility regression testing integrated into your release cycle.
Game Accessibility Testing
A specialist vertical within our accessibility practice. We test games across mobile, PC, and console against CVAA, Xbox Accessibility Guidelines (XAGs), Game Accessibility Guidelines (GAG), and PlayStation Accessibility standards, covering colorblind modes, subtitle quality, adaptive controller support, motor accessibility, and photosensitivity screening.
Accessibility Audit & VPAT Service
For organisations that need documented proof of compliance for procurement, legal, or certification purposes, we deliver comprehensive accessibility audits with severity-classified defect reports, remediation guidance, and fully-prepared Voluntary Product Accessibility Templates (VPATs) across WCAG 2.1/2.2 and Section 508 Revised criteria.

Our Methodology

Automated Accessibility Testing
We deploy axe-core, WAVE, Lighthouse, and Deque tools integrated into your CI/CD pipeline to continuously scan for detectable WCAG violations on every build, catching regressions before they reach users.

Keyboard Accessibility Testing
We verify every interaction, modal, dropdown, form, and data table is fully operable via keyboard alone, including visible focus indicators, logical tab order, keyboard traps, and skip navigation links.

VPAT & Compliance Documentation
We produce fully-prepared Voluntary Product Accessibility Templates and accessibility conformance reports that satisfy enterprise procurement, government contract requirements, and EAA documentation obligations.

Screen Reader Testing
Expert testers validate your software using NVDA, JAWS, VoiceOver (macOS/iOS), TalkBack (Android), and Microsoft Narrator; testing reading order, focus management, ARIA label accuracy, and dynamic content announcements.

Visual & Colour Accessibility Testing
We test colour contrast ratios against WCAG 1.4.3 and 1.4.11, validate colourblind-safe design across protanopia/deuteranopia/tritanopia profiles, and verify text resizing, spacing, and reflow compliance up to 400% zoom.
